What are Scratchings?

In horse racing, scratchings refer to horses that are withdrawn from a race after the official declaration of the field. This can occur for various reasons, ranging from injury or illness to unsatisfactory form or a desire to reroute the horse to a different race.

Analyzing the Impact of Melbourne Cup Scratchings 2023

Effect on the Race Dynamics

Scratchings can have a profound impact on the race dynamics. The withdrawal of even a single horse, particularly a fancied runner, can alter the field's overall composition and influence the betting market. The removal of a top contender can open the door for other horses to emerge as favorites, while the scratching of a lesser-rated entrant may have minimal impact on the race's outcome.
